Hannah Ferrier, former star of Below Deck Mediterranean, has officially welcomed her new baby girl, Ava, into the world. The chief stewardess even shared some adorable pictures of her sweet baby with her fans.

Bravo viewers found out at the beginning of June that Hannah and her Aussie boyfriend were expecting a baby. After Hannah’s untimely departure from the cast of Below Deck Med due to unprescribed drugs on board the ship, a new baby gave fans hope that Hannah had something positive to look forward to. Viewers did note that, for the last season or two, Hannah has not been cheerful while on the job. In the end, her bad attitude and flagrant disregard for maritime law led to her demise.

On Monday, November 2, the former Bravo fan-favorite revealed to her fans via Instagram that her daughter had arrived. Fans have been included in her entire pregnancy journey and were beyond excited to finally meet the new bundle of joy. In her touching social media post, Hannah was all smiles as she stared down at her little girl. Both Hannah and Ava wore white dresses, and Hannah’s featured lace and bell sleeves. The 33-year-old looked stunning with her blonde hair tossed to the side over her shoulder as she cuddled baby girl. The chief stew’s message read, Madam has arrived! Josh and I are so happy to welcome to the world our little girl - Ava Grace Roberts. Born on the 26th of October. She is already a little menace that has captured our hearts forever.”  See her full post below:

The reality star posted a collage of newborn photos that showed baby Ava with dark hair swaddled in a blanket of love. The last picture showed the precious newborn yawning and opening her eyes to the big, new world. Fans have waited with bated breath for the announcement of Hannah's baby, since she actually gave birth a week ago. Hannah's Instagram story showed baby Ava at one day old, sleeping with a deep lip pout while wrapped in a rainbow blanket. The reality star also shared a picture of the new family being welcomed home from the hospital. The baby was surrounded by balloons and love.

Even though Hannah is no longer part of the Below Deck Mediterranean cast, many of her co-stars reached out to congratulate her. Fans are hoping she keeps her followers updated about her new journey of motherhood.
